Yusef Name Meaning — Hebrew Origin, Multi-faith Usage & History

Yusef is a timeless name with profound religious significance across multiple faiths. Derived from the Hebrew name Yosef, meaning ‘God will add,’ it has been embraced by Jewish, Christian, and Muslim communities for centuries. The name is most famously associated with the prophet Joseph (Yusuf in Arabic), whose story appears in both the Bible and the Quran. Today, Yusef remains a popular choice for boys worldwide, symbolizing divine blessing and increase.

Meaning of Yusef

The name Yusef originates from the Hebrew Yosef (יוֹסֵף), which comes from the root verb ‘yasaf’ (יסף) meaning ‘to add’ or ‘to increase.’ In a theological context, this translates to ‘God will add’ or ‘God shall multiply,’ reflecting a prayer for divine blessing and prosperity. In Arabic, the name became Yūsuf (يُوسُف) through linguistic adaptation, maintaining the same core meaning. The name is deeply embedded in Abrahamic traditions, appearing in the Hebrew Bible, the Christian New Testament, and the Quran, where Surah Yusuf is dedicated to the prophet’s story. This consistent meaning across Semitic languages highlights its enduring spiritual significance.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Yusef has its roots in ancient Hebrew culture, where it was borne by the patriarch Joseph, son of Jacob and Rachel. The name spread through Aramaic and Greek (as Iōsēph) before entering Arabic as Yūsuf with the rise of Islam in the 7th century. In Islamic tradition, Yusuf is revered as a prophet mentioned in the Quran, known for his beauty, wisdom, and moral integrity. The name is widely used across the Muslim world, from Arabic-speaking regions to South Asia (e.g., Urdu, Persian, Pashto) and beyond. It also remains common among Jewish and Christian communities, often in forms like Joseph or Yosef, demonstrating its cross-cultural and multi-faith appeal.

Famous People Named Yusef

  • Yusuf Islam (Cat Stevens) — British singer-songwriter and Muslim convert
  • Youssef Chahine — Egyptian film director
  • Yusuf Pathan — Indian cricketer
  • Yosef Karo — 16th-century Jewish legal scholar
  • Joseph (Yusuf) — Biblical and Quranic prophet
